Understanding Smart Vacuum Technology

Smart vacuums use a combination of sensors, cameras, and expert system to browse through homes. They can identify barriers, prevent dropping stairs, and efficiently map the design of a space to ensure thorough cleaning. Here are some crucial elements that make these gadgets intelligent:

Key Features of Smart Vacuums

  1. Navigation Systems: Utilizing laser mapping or video camera vision innovations, smart vacuums develop a map of a home's design, allowing them to clean systematically instead of randomly.
  2. Scheduling and Remote Control: Many devices included mobile phone apps or voice assistant abilities, making it possible for users to begin, stop, or schedule cleaning sessions from another location.
  3. Varied Cleaning Modes: Smart vacuums often consist of different cleaning modes like area cleaning, edge cleaning, and a general cleaning cycle customized to different areas and surface areas.
  4. Self-Charging: When the battery runs low, smart vacuums can autonomously go back to their charging stations, guaranteeing they're constantly ready for the next cleaning session.
  5. Smart Home Integration: Compatibility with platforms like Amazon Alexa or Google Home permits users to manage their vacuums with voice commands.

The Benefits of Smart Vacuums

Smart vacuums offer various benefits that deal with contemporary lifestyles. Some of the benefits include:

  • Time-Saving: Automated cleaning indicates house owners can invest less time managing home tasks.
  • Convenience: Scheduling cleanings permits for upkeep to continue even when occupants are away.
  • Thorough Cleaning: Advanced sensing units make it possible for smart vacuums to navigate difficult-to-reach locations, ensuring an extensive cleaning.
  • Pet-Friendly Options: Many models are developed to handle family pet hair and dander, relieving the concern for pet owners.

Potential Drawbacks of Smart Vacuums

Regardless of the numerous benefits, there are some limitations to consider when investing in a smart vacuum:

  • Initial Cost: Smart vacuums can be more pricey than standard vacuums, possibly making them less available for budget-conscious customers.
  • Upkeep Requirements: While the machines do the cleaning, they still need regular upkeep, such as clearing dustbins and cleaning brushes.

Smart Vacuums vs. Traditional Vacuums

When deciding between smart vacuums and standard vacuum cleaners, it's important to weigh the pros and cons of each alternative.

Conventional Vacuum Advantages

  • Powerful Suction: Generally, traditional vacuums provide more powerful suction and can deal with larger messes.
  • Flexibility: They can much better manage a variety of surface areas, including upholstery and stairs.
  • Lower Upfront Costs: Traditional vacuums been available in a large range of prices, making them available for lots of homes.

Smart Vacuum Advantages

  • Automated Cleaning: They permit simple and easy, scheduled cleaning without human intervention.
  • Space Saving: Smart vacuums are compact and can be quickly saved in little areas.
  • Technological Proficiency: Many models provide functions like mapping, app control, and voice help.

Often Asked Questions About Smart Vacuums

1. How efficient are smart vacuums in cleaning homes?

Smart vacuums are normally reliable for routine cleaning of dirt and debris, especially on tough floors and low-pile carpets. Nevertheless, they may not replace deep cleaning for carpets.

2. Can smart vacuums manage pet hair?

Yes, many smart vacuums are particularly created with effective suction and brush systems to tackle animal hair, making them an excellent choice for family pet owners.

3. How do I keep my smart vacuum?

Routine upkeep consists of emptying the dustbin, cleaning the filters, and inspecting the brushes. Describe the producer's standards for specific upkeep ideas.

4. Are smart vacuums noisy?

Smart vacuums normally produce less noise than traditional vacuums, making them a quieter choice for everyday cleaning tasks.

5. Do smart vacuums work on carpet?

Lots of smart vacuums can clean low to medium-pile carpets efficiently, but efficiency may differ by design. Always inspect the requirements to make sure optimal performance on your carpets.
